The check engine light on the Nissan Patrol Hardtop GR signals that the engine management system has detected an anomaly--be it faulty sensors, misfires, or emissions control issues--that may compromise performance if not promptly diagnosed. Prioritizing data from on-board diagnostics (OBD-II) is critical, as scanning for specific trouble codes will guide targeted maintenance and help prevent escalation of the underlying problem.

Nissan Patrol Hardtop GR check engine light on meaning

Loose Gas Cap

A loose or missing gas cap can trigger the check engine light due to fuel vapor leaks.

Failing Catalytic Converter

A clogged or failing catalytic converter can cause performance issues and emissions problems.

Fouled Spark Plugs or Spark Plug Wires

Faulty spark plugs or wires can lead to engine misfires and reduced performance.

Faulty Oxygen Sensor

A malfunctioning oxygen sensor can disrupt the air-fuel mixture, affecting engine efficiency.

Faulty Mass Air Flow Sensor

A faulty MAF sensor can cause misfires and poor fuel economy.

Low Engine Oil

Insufficient engine oil can lead to premature wear and engine failure.

Turbo Pressure Issues

Problems like cracked or loose hoses can cause low turbo pressure.

Fuel System Trouble

Issues with fuel delivery can result in poor performance or engine stalling.

Faulty Wiring Connections

Poor connections, especially in rough conditions, can trigger the check engine light.

Faulty Fuel Filter

Issues with the fuel filter, such as a malfunctioning float mechanism, can cause intermittent problems.

If the check engine light on your Nissan Patrol Hardtop GR comes on, first ensure your vehicle is safely stopped by checking basic levels--oil, coolant, and gas cap--and listen for any unusual sounds or smells. Next, use an affordable OBD-II scanner to retrieve error codes or visit a trusted mechanic for a detailed diagnosis, so you can immediately target the specific issues and prioritize necessary repairs.

Ignoring the check engine light

Ignoring the Nissan Patrol Hardtop GR's check engine light can result in further undiagnosed engine misfires, sensor failures, or catalytic converter issues, which may ultimately compromise engine performance, fuel efficiency, and emissions control. Persistent neglect risks escalating minor faults into costly engine system damages that significantly reduce the vehicle's reliability and long-term value.

How to reset?

Use an OBD-II scanner to read, record, and clear the diagnostic trouble codes on your Nissan Patrol Hardtop GR, ensuring that all sensor data and system parameters are within manufacturer specifications before proceeding. If the check engine light reappears after the reset, perform a comprehensive diagnostic to address any underlying issues, and consult a certified mechanic for further technical assistance.

When the check engine light comes on in a Nissan Patrol Hardtop GR, a basic diagnostic fee is typically between $75 and $150, while further repairs can range from $500 up to $1,500 or more depending on the specific components affected. Labor usually accounts for 60-70% of the total cost, making an accurate diagnostic crucial for prioritizing the replacement of high-cost parts such as sensors, catalytic converters, or engine components.

Future prevention

Ensure the Nissan Patrol Hardtop GR undergoes regular, manufacturer-recommended maintenance--including timely sensor replacements (oxygen, MAF), spark plugs, filters, and fluid checks--to keep core engine functions optimized and prevent triggering the check engine light. Routinely performing diagnostic scans, using high-quality fuel, and addressing even minor fault codes immediately are critical data-driven practices that significantly reduce the risk of engine malfunctions and costly repairs.
